The following example shows the `/scale` subresource contract. +In order to use the VPA with a custom resource, when you create the `CustomResourceDefinition` (CRD) object, you must configure the `labelSelectorPath` field in the `/scale` subresource. The `/scale` subresource creates a `Scale` object. The `labelSelectorPath` field defines the JSON path inside the custom resource that corresponds to `Status.Selector` in the `Scale` object and in the custom resource. The following is an example of a `CustomResourceDefinition` and a `CustomResource` that fulfills these requirements, along with a `VerticalPodAutoscaler` definition that targets the custom resource. The following example shows the `/scale` subresource contract. Operators use custom resources (CR) to manage applications and their components. High-level configuration and settings are provided by the user within a CR. The Operator translates high-level directives into low-level actions, based on best practices embedded within the Operator’s logic. A custom resource definition (CRD) defines a CR and lists all the configurations available to users of the Operator. Installing an Operator creates the CRDs, which are then used to generate CRs. == Operator CRs: -* `Red Hat Openshift Logging Operator` +* `Red Hat OpenShift Logging Operator` ** (Deprecated) `ClusterLogging` (CL) - Deploys the collector and forwarder which currently are both implemented by a daemonset running on each node. ** `ClusterLogForwarder` (CLF) - Generates collector configuration to forward logs per user configuration. * `Loki Operator`: diff --git a/scalability_and_performance/index.adoc b/scalability_and_performance/index.adoc index 15937cda6e..2336cb384a 100644 --- a/scalability_and_performance/index.adoc +++ b/scalability_and_performance/index.adoc @@ -13,7 +13,7 @@ To contact Red Hat support, see xref:../support/getting-support.adoc#getting-sup [NOTE] ==== -Some performance and scalability Operators have release cycles that are independent from {product-title} release cycles.
